Magnetic Nanomaterials-Based Sensors for the Detection and Monitoring of Toxic Gases,rs, considering their principles, types, applications, strengths, and demerits. The discussed MNM-based sensors are electrochemical, optical, piezoelectric and magnetic. An overview of the recent literature is given, and their various applications are also presented therein.
